  1. Number 1: Was Your Migraine Misdiagnosed? 5 Clues Your Doctor Got Your Headache Wrong

    What if your migraine diagnosis isn't necessarily wrong—but it isn't telling you the whole story? In this episode of the Headache Doctor Podcast, Dr. Taves shares five clues that your headaches or migraines may have an overlooked neck-related component. Instead of looking only at symptoms like nausea, light sensitivity, throbbing, and one-sided pain, he explains why it's important to ask what's actually driving your nervous system to become so sensitive in the first place. The 5 clues he breaks down are:Your pain starts in—or is connected to—your neckWeather and barometric pressure changes trigger your symptomsExercise triggers a headache or migraineYour symptoms are consistently one-sidedYou have ongoing jaw, neck, or shoulder tensionDr. Taves also explains why normal X-rays, MRIs, or CT scans don't necessarily tell you how well your neck is moving or functioning—and why these clues may warrant a closer look at the neck, jaw, and shoulders. Plus, in Ask the Headache Doctor, Dr. Taves answers questions about distinguishing cervicogenic headaches from migraines and the role hormonal changes may play in migraine threshold.   2. Number 2: Could Your Gut Be Lowering Your Migraine Threshold?

    Could what’s happening in your gut be affecting how vulnerable you are to migraines? In this episode of the Headache Doctor Podcast, Dr. Taves sits down with functional health practitioner Taylor Knese of Mod Health Co. to explore the connection between gut health, hormones, stress, inflammation, and migraine threshold. They break down how the gut communicates with the brain, why digestion and bowel movements can offer clues about your overall health, and how imbalances involving estrogen, histamine, stress, and the gut microbiome may contribute to a lower migraine threshold.   3. Number 3: The Real Root Cause of Migraines: Why Your Neck Might Be the Missing Piece

    Is migraine really a neurological disease—or could your neck be the missing piece? In this episode of the Headache Doctor Podcast, Dr. Taves challenges one of the most common beliefs about migraines. He explains why a migraine diagnosis is based on symptoms—not necessarily the underlying cause—and why many people continue searching for answers after normal MRIs, CT scans, and medications. You'll learn how the neck, jaw, and shoulders can send pain into the same pathways that process migraine symptoms, why imaging often misses the real problem, and a simple self-assessment you can do at home to see whether your neck may be contributing to your headaches.
